在PHP中,下载文件时遇到乱码问题是一个常见的问题。以下是一个实例,以及解决这个问题的方法。
实例描述
假设我们有一个中文文件`example.txt`,内容如下:
```
这是一个中文文件,包含中文字符。
```
现在我们想使用PHP编写一个脚本,允许用户下载这个文件。但是,当用户下载文件时,文件内容显示为乱码。
代码示例
```php
header('Content-Description: File Transfer');
header('Content-Type: application/octet-stream');
header('Content-Disposition: attachment; filename="